The Vermont
Grass Farmers' Association (VGFA) was founded in 1996 with
support from the UVM Center for Sustainable Agriculture and USDA-NRCS.
The VGFA helps
farmers generate wealth from
grass-based farming, provides leadership on grazing issues, and vision
for the Center's Vermont Pasture Network
Program.
VGFA membership coordinates with the calendar year. Yearly memberships cost $40 and end December 31.
Benefits of VGFA membership include
- Discount at the annual Vermont Grazing & Livestock Conference
- Quarterly Solar Dollar newsletter
- Free listing in the Grass Fed Directory of Products
- Access and discounts to pasture walks and educational events
- Mini grant opportunities
- Voting rights and a voice in the farmer organization setting priorities for grazing in Vermont.
